Hi All,

I went in to my local trusted garage today (not the dealership) for an alignment, and received a phone call shortly after dropping the car off. I was told that they couldn't do the alignment because it was discovered that my left front coil spring has damage ("a broken piece") at the bottom, as does my right rear coil spring! I have no idea how this could have happened without me noticing something change in the ride feel... but what do I know.

Anyway, the parts aren't listed with his suppliers. I'm afraid to even ask the dealership for a quote, although I WILL call tomorrow. It's also advisable to replace all 4, rather than just those 2 - so that makes matters worse $$$.

Can anyone point me towards coil springs for a 2009 Genesis 3.8L V6? I've been searching but can't find anything. It's apparently just the springs themselves that have the damage. Maybe there's an aftermarket brand that makes some that will fit just fine.
